Pokemon Tier List Ranking Systems

Different ranking systems are used to categorize Pokemon, each representing a different level of competitive play. The most common systems include OU (OverUsed), UU (UnderUsed), and NU (NeverUsed). These tiers are not static; Pokemon can move between tiers depending on their usage and effectiveness within the metagame. OU represents the strongest and most commonly used Pokemon, while UU and NU represent progressively less used Pokemon.

Beyond these, even lower tiers exist, such as PU (RarelyUsed) and ZU (Zero Usage). The specific criteria for moving between tiers vary slightly depending on the specific tier list creator, but generally involve a combination of usage rate and win rate data.

Key Stats and Abilities

Base stats, particularly HP, Attack, Defense, Special Attack, Special Defense, and Speed, form the foundational pillars of a Pokémon’s effectiveness. High base stats in relevant offensive or defensive categories directly translate to a Pokémon’s ability to deal and withstand damage. For instance, a Pokémon with exceptionally high Attack and Speed will likely excel as a sweeper, quickly eliminating opponents.

Conversely, high Defense and HP provide crucial bulk, enabling the Pokémon to withstand attacks and set up strategies. Abilities play a pivotal role, often augmenting a Pokémon’s stats or providing crucial utility. For example, the ability “Chlorophyll” doubles a Grass-type Pokémon’s Speed in sunlight, dramatically enhancing its offensive capabilities. Similarly, “Intimidate” lowers the opponent’s Attack stat, providing a significant defensive advantage.

The synergy between base stats and abilities is critical; a Pokémon with excellent stats but a weak or irrelevant ability may not perform as well as expected.

Community Perception and Tier List Variations

Tier lists in the Pokémon competitive scene are not static entities; they are dynamic reflections of both objective data and subjective community perception. While websites like Smogon and Pikalytics utilize statistical analysis of competitive battles to inform their rankings, the ultimate placement of a Pokémon often involves a degree of interpretation and community consensus. This interplay between data-driven analysis and community opinion leads to variations in tier lists across different sources and even shifts in rankings over time.Different tier list sources employ varying methodologies and data sets.

For example, Smogon’s tiers are often determined through extensive testing and community discussion, leading to a more nuanced and arguably more debated system. Pikalytics, on the other hand, primarily relies on raw usage and win-rate statistics from a large dataset of online battles, providing a more statistically-driven, albeit potentially less contextually rich, perspective. These differences in approach inevitably result in discrepancies in Pokémon rankings.

A Pokémon might be considered high-tier in one system but mid-tier in another, highlighting the subjective element at play.

Smogon vs. Pikalytics Tier List Discrepancies

The discrepancies between Smogon and Pikalytics tier lists often stem from the differing ways they account for factors beyond raw win rates. Smogon’s system takes into account factors such as team composition, strategic flexibility, and overall metagame impact, which are harder to quantify statistically. Pikalytics, with its focus on sheer win rate data, might overemphasize the performance of Pokémon that thrive in specific metagame niches or under specific team compositions, without fully capturing their broader competitive viability.

For example, a Pokémon might boast a high win rate in Pikalytics due to its success against a prevalent meta threat, but Smogon might place it lower due to its relative vulnerability against other common threats or its limited strategic utility. This difference underscores the tension between objective performance metrics and subjective assessment of overall competitive value.

Examples of Drastic Metagame Shifts

The introduction of Mega Evolution in Pokémon X and Y drastically altered the competitive landscape. Mega Mewtwo X, for instance, became an extremely powerful and dominant force, significantly shaping team building strategies. Similarly, the release of Generation VI brought many powerful Pokémon that quickly climbed the tier lists, shifting the existing meta. The introduction of new abilities like Protean in Generation VI also created highly effective strategies that were previously impossible.

These shifts required significant updates to tier lists as the metagame adjusted to these new elements. Another notable example is the impact of the Fairy type introduced in Generation VI. The Fairy type countered the previously dominant Dragon type, leading to a significant re-evaluation of many Dragon-type Pokémon’s placement on the tier list. The sudden rise in the popularity and effectiveness of Fairy-type Pokémon fundamentally altered the competitive metagame.
